The new Mitsubishi TBR30N, is an all-new, high-spec tow truck that shares many features with its stablemate, the OPB20NE low level order picker - winner of the latest FLTA Award for Ergonomics.

Designed for indoor use, primarily within the automotive sector, the TBR30N blends operator comfort, precision control and strength.

Among many new features are its user-friendly Maxius steering wheel and controls. Progressive steering, automatic speed reduction when corning and drive wheel centring deliver total driver confidence when manoeuvring at speeds of up to 12 km/hr. A safe limit of 2.5 km/hr is automatically set in walk-beside mode.

A small turning circle, responsive steering and a compact chassis, result in 'exceptional manoeuvrability', with the spacious operator compartment, comfortable backrest and adjustable folding seat boosting productivity.
